Como alterar o realce de sintaxe padrão para arquivo de cabeçalho no Kate

Como alterar o realce de sintaxe padrão para arquivo de cabeçalho no Kate

Muitas vezes eu tenho que abrir arquivos de cabeçalho (com terminação .h) emKate. O realce de sintaxe padrão com o qual esses arquivos serão abertos é sempre C++. Como isso poderia ser alterado para Fortranque eu não precise mudar manualmente?

Editar1:

Já adicionei um *.h; à lista de extensões em fortran.xml em

~/.kde/share/apps/katepart/syntax/

mas isso não ajuda. *.h;também está incluído em vários outros XMLarquivos no diretório superior.

A propósito: A prioridade em ambos os arquivos cpp.xmle fortran.xmlé 9.

Editar2:

Testei as modificações nos XMLarquivos sempre reiniciandoKatecom os mesmos arquivos. Aqui não vejo alterações. Mas, se eu fechar e reabrir os mesmos arquivos, funciona.

Responder1

Kate está usando agora~/.kde/share/config/katemoderc

  1. Na GUI: menu Kate → Configurações → Configurar o Kate... → Componente Editor → Abrir/Salvar → Modos e tipos de arquivos

  2. Selecione o tipo de arquivo:, Sources/Fortranadicione ;*.hextensões de arquivo, aumente a prioridade de 9para 15(deve estar ok, a prioridade máxima para .hestava em Sources/C++que é 9)

    adicionando .h ao modo fortran

  3. Feche e reabra os arquivos.

Responder2

Para o Kate 17.04.3 o diretório de sintaxe é ~/.local/share/org.kde.syntax-highlighting/syntax

informação relacionada